Output 51703a85664d79f53ac0e076ec57c46427056c582389a0e4f78e7d43d80352a4:4

value
188600
script pubkey
OP_0 OP_PUSHBYTES_20 4adc0017c6ddb3497d2222754fca683cd66d7f6a
address
bc1qftwqq97xmke5jlfzyf65ljng8ntx6lm23dznua
transaction
51703a85664d79f53ac0e076ec57c46427056c582389a0e4f78e7d43d80352a4
spent
true